In that case (here comes the hate) I would take the Chevy.
The deck on the 400 is so tall and the stroke so short that the R/S ratio is on the high side anyway and the piston would be horribly top heavy.
You start getting to 8k plus with a piston like that and your ring seal (under load) will be compromised too much.
Even if you coated the skirts and you were running with a clearance of .0015 (or less) it still would be far too compromised to be competitive.
If you could get a 400 block with say a 9.200 deck that thing would smoke some ***.
